Poetry. "With its one-two of exuberant wit and vigorous philosophical inquiry, Nick Courtright's PUNCHLINE is nothing short of a knockout."—Timothy Donnelly

"Between the infinity of the universe and the futility of small matters, along with the prophet and the fatalist, PUNCHLINE travels. It's a tightrope performance Nick Courtright is embarking on here, knowing full well that these necessary turns to the large abstractions of 'enlightenment' and the 'apse of consciousness' are hanging threadbare above us, and at any moment all our understanding could be 'revised by pamphlets fallen / from the sky, or by Adobe Photoshop.' These are fundamental, open questions, and they anchor a wonderful book."—John Gallaher

"By turns elliptical and aphoristic, macrocosmic and microcosmic, timeless and contemporary, PUNCHLINE is not a book of poems for those who merely want to be diverted or amused; this work is for readers who consider poetry the natural sibling of philosophy. Nick Courtright's finely-distilled poems mine the frustrating unknowableness of the world, and celebrate its exhilarating mystery with elegance, compassion, and imagination."—Nicky Beer

About the Author
Nick Courtright is the author of Punchline, a 2012 National Poetry Series finalist, and Let There Be Light, published in 2014 by Gold Wake Press. His work has appeared in The Southern Review, Boston Review, and Kenyon Review Online, among numerous others, and a chapbook, Elegy for the Builder's Wife, is available from Blue Hour Press. �He lives in Austin, Texas with his wife, Michelle, and sons, William and Samuel. A talented poet
By Anne
This is an impressive collection--both in terms of the very careful craft of the poems and in terms of the weighty content of the ideas. These are no poems about peeling potatoes: Courtright tackles ambitious subject matter, from philosophy to science to the meaning we can make of human emotion, and he always comes to satisfactory endings. (This is something I find SO hard to do once I broach philosophical questioning). In terms of craft, Courtright relies mostly on lyric and elliptical poems with only the slightest hint at narrative sometimes, and he does so masterfully. The poems feel carefully wrought--nothing extraneous, nothing missing--and the line breaks and forms the poems took always felt tremendously satisfied. My favorite poem in the collection (though many are very good) is the title poem "Punchline." This was the most thought provoking and emotionally resonant piece for me personally. A talented poet.

Poems about the World Beyond, Below, and Within
By Gerry M. Hopkins
Nick Courtright's debut collection Punchline demonstrates impressive range and skill. In addition to his finely-crafted free verse, Courtright consistently surprises us with his philosophical expansiveness and his careful attention to the minutiae of nature. For example, he observes that humans "seek the face of God/ and find it/on the internet. Maybe/ the face of God was always there, in the sand itself,/ and the ant had access to it." These are poems that seek everything, question everything, yet take nothing for granted. Sometimes mystical, other times existential, these poems address themes that would be at home in the work of Blake, Whitman, and Bly. However, despite the grand sweep of his ideas, Courtright works in carefully-controlled verse, somehow managing to pack a cosmic wallop into terse, well-wrought lyrics.
